Martinsburg, West Virginia native David Hunter Strother was appointed Consul to Mexico by President Rutherford B. Hayes in 1879. The photograph was taken in the gardens called Tivoli De San Cosme at Espiritu Santo, Mexico. Strother is front and center with the white, flowing beard.

'Wm. L., C. M., F. G., H. A., James T. and Joe F. Webber; Reunion in Salem, Va., April 15, 1890 of brothers who had not met since 1861.'
